Are you a proactive marketer with a flair for content, digital campaigns, and lead generation? Looking for a role where your ideas are valued, and your work makes a real impact? We’re working with a brilliant B2B business in Gloucestershire that’s looking for a confident, creative Marketing Executive to join their collaborative and friendly team. With a focus on innovative solutions, the business has customers across multiple sectors — and marketing plays a big part in their continued growth. This is a hybrid role (2 days office / 3 from home) with flexible hours, a culture built on trust and wellbeing, and the chance to grow your career in a values-led environment.

What you’ll be doing:

  • Supporting and delivering targeted marketing campaigns to generate leads
  • Creating and managing content across social media, email, website and CRM
  • Collaborating with the Marketing Manager and external agencies
  • Getting involved with events, internal comms, and brand development
  • Working closely with sales and service teams to align messaging and outreach
  • Monitoring performance data and reporting on marketing activity
  • Ensuring consistency across all digital and offline touchpoints

What we’re looking for:

  • 2–3 years’ experience in a marketing role (B2B experience a plus)
  • Confident with digital channels – social, web, email, CRM
  • A creative thinker with strong writing and communication skills
  • Comfortable working independently and collaboratively
  • Someone who thrives in a flexible, fast-moving environment

You’ll be supported by a Marketing Manager and part of a genuinely welcoming and values-driven team. Career development is actively encouraged. If you’re looking for a dynamic, supportive role where you can make your mark — we’d love to hear from you!

How to prepare for a job interview at Rocking Zebra

Showcase Your Creative Campaigns

Get ready to flaunt your portfolio! Include examples of previous marketing campaigns you've worked on, especially those that showcase your creativity and strategy. Recruiters at Rocking Zebra will be keen to see how you conceptualise and execute campaigns, so highlight any measurable outcomes to back up your claims.

Know Your Digital Tools Inside Out

If you’re heading into a marketing-communications role, make sure you're comfortable discussing key digital marketing tools like Google Analytics, HubSpot, or Hootsuite. Expect some technical questions about how you've used these tools in the past, as they'll want to gauge your hands-on experience and how you analyse data to drive marketing decisions.

Be Ready for Scenario-Based Questions

At Rocking Zebra, they may throw some scenario-based questions your way, aimed at testing your problem-solving skills in real-life marketing situations. Think through potential challenges you’ve faced, how you navigated them, and be prepared to discuss your thought process and outcome.
